What is the Meaning & Definition of gloss

Depending on the context in which use it, the word gloss will present various references. The explanation, commentary on a text is called a gloss. Generally, to the gloss type it is in the margins or between the lines of the book in question in which we proceed to explain the meaning of the text in its original language; This situation is that glosses vary in the complexity of present and then can go from simple and simple notes aside on some words that the reader may find difficult or to translations of the original text complete more references of similar paragraphs.
The resource of the gloss was widely used in medieval Biblical Theology and therefore many of the glosses of those times were studied, memorized by his own imprint, independently of the author, moreover, in some cases a passage from the Bible was best known for a note in particular that so per was held. The same phenomenon occurred in the medieval legal, for example, the glosses on Roman law and Canon law were relevant reference points in those days.
Meanwhile, in the field of Philology, the discipline that deals with the study of written texts, glosses also have a key role, especially in those cases in which there is very little written material of the author of the gloss. In some situations the glosses have been light on the vocabulary used in some past languages that otherwise might never have been known.
